North Korea missile reports prompt prayer plea

A Christian peer who founded a parliamentary group to monitor North Korea also encouraged believers to pray that China might exercise wisdom as its key mediator.

Co-chair of the group, Lord Alton, told Premier: "Wisdom should be at the forefront of the situation on all sides in dealing with North Korea.

"Simply increasing the retoric and name-calling makes a dangerous situation even more dangerous."

AP Photo and Lee Jin-man

Officials in South Korea and the United States have been monitoring the trajectory of the missile, which Seoul claims launched from an early north of Pyongyang early on Wednesday.

Urging North Korea to adher to cease actions which might esalate tensions, China aso said it was "seriously concerned" by the apparent latest missle launch.

The test was condenmed as a "provocative action" by Russia, which warned the move could damage efforts to resolve the ongoing crisis.

Lord Alton added: "I am not surprised that they [the North Koreans] have cranked up the rachet, this is something that they have done seriously."
